Festo SPTE Series Pressure Sensors

Festo SPTE series pressure transmitters for simple and quick pressure monitoring. The intelligent fitting delivers instant information about the current pressure and is equally effective for object detection via back pressure as well as for pressure, regulation and vacuum detection.
